In a world where winter reigns, four siblings stumble upon a wardrobe that serves as a portal to the enchanting land of Narnia. As they explore this mysterious realm, they encounter an array of whimsical creatures and face the dark magic of the White Witch, who has cast an eternal winter over the land. It is in Narnia that their courage and bond as a family are put to the test as they embark on an adventure filled with trials and triumphs.
Amidst the snow-covered landscape, they meet Aslan, a majestic lion who symbolizes hope and bravery. Aslan's powerful presence inspires the children to join the fight against the Witch’s cruelty and restore peace to Narnia. Their journey is not just a quest for freedom; it also serves as a rite of passage that deepens their understanding of friendship, loyalty, and sacrifice.
With its captivating illustrations, this edition brings the timeless tale to life, drawing readers into a vividly imagined world of magic where good battles evil. This story resonates with the young and the young at heart, leaving them enchanted by the allure of Narnia and the important themes woven throughout their adventure.
